Composer:Mary RodgersGenre:Musical TheatreStyle:Musical Theater'Once Upon a Mattress' is a musical comedy with music composed by Mary Rodgers, lyrics by Marshall Barer, and book by Jay Thompson, Dean Fuller, and Marshall Barer. The musical is based on the fairy tale 'The Princess and the Pea' and tells the story of Princess Winnifred, who arrives at Prince Dauntless's castle to compete for his hand in marriage. However, the Queen, who has been controlling the kingdom and the Prince's love life, sets up impossible tests for the Princess to pass. The musical is a hilarious take on the classic fairy tale, with a modern twist. The musical was first composed in 1958 and premiered on Broadway in 1959. The original production was directed by George Abbott and choreographed by Joe Layton. The musical starred Carol Burnett as Princess Winnifred and was a huge success, running for 244 performances. The musical was later revived on Broadway in 1970, 1996, and 2005. The musical is composed of two acts and features several memorable songs, including 'Shy', 'Sensitivity', and 'Happily Ever After'.
